Output e90286f3e05618756f9544ecd95dfb4fed07955c60b18a6a6230aefa394f9016:1

value
2735000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 071ae2e0e02343f8bc4d975b39f55d933443af09 OP_EQUALVERIFY OP_CHECKSIG
address
1eZwS3XEAdoEiSxKziy16ePJvhSymr4Uy
transaction
e90286f3e05618756f9544ecd95dfb4fed07955c60b18a6a6230aefa394f9016
spent
true